How it works (beginner friendly)
Clearing a warrant in Minnesota involves several steps:
-
Locate the warrant: Find out which court issued the warrant and the specific charges associated with it.
-
Understand the warrant type: Determine whether the warrant is for a misdemeanor, felony, or other offense.
-
Contact the issuing court: Reach out to the court that issued the warrant and inquire about the necessary steps to lift it.
-
Pay the fine or take a diversion program: Depending on the warrant type, you may need to pay a fine or participate in a diversion program to lift the warrant.
Common questions
Can I lift a warrant myself?
While it's possible to attempt to lift a warrant on your own, it's often recommended to seek the guidance of an attorney or a warrant clearing professional. They can help navigate the process and ensure that all necessary steps are taken.
How long does it take to lift a warrant?
The time it takes to lift a warrant varies depending on the complexity of the case, the court's schedule, and the efficiency of the warrant clearing process. In some cases, it may take several weeks or even months to resolve the issue.
Will lifting a warrant affect my credit score?
Lifting a warrant itself typically doesn't directly impact your credit score. However, unresolved warrants can lead to further complications, such as civil contempt charges or additional fines, which might affect your credit.
Can I lift a warrant if I'm not in Minnesota?
If you're not physically present in Minnesota, it may be more challenging to lift a warrant. You can try to contact the issuing court and follow their instructions, but it's often recommended to seek the assistance of a local attorney or warrant clearing professional.
